For the Petitioner/s : Mr. Durgesh Nandan For the Opposite Party/s : Mr. A.Dayal(App) ====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E DINESH KUMAR SINGH ORAL ORDER 02/ 14-09-2016 Heard learned counsels for the petitioner and the State.

The petitioner being the husband of the complainant has renewed his prayer for anticipatory bail in a complaint case wherein process has been directed to be issued after cognizance being taken for the offences punishable under Sections 498A of the Indian Penal Code and 4 of the Dowry Prohibition Act.

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.9084 of 2016 (2) dt.14-09-2016 2/3 The basic accusation is of torture for nonfulfillment of the dowry demand. It is submitted by learned counsel for the petitioner that the petitioner admits his marriage with the complainant and is not ready to reconcile the issue due to the past conduct of the complainant.

The earlier anticipatory bail application of the petitioner was disposed of vide order dated 29.01.2016 passed in Cr. Misc. No. 55446 of 2015 since the petitioner was not ready to accept the offer of the complainant to resume the conjugal life.

It is further submitted by learned counsel for the petitioner that the petitioner has renewed his prayer for anticipatory bail on the ground that petitioner is ready to make certain payment for the welfare of the complainant, though, petitioner has filed Matrimonial Suit No. 1982 of 2014/T.M.S. No. 234 of 2014 with a prayer for divorce subsequent to the filing of the complaint petition.

The aforesaid facts may be a ground for consideration of prayer for bail, if the petitioner surrenders before the learned court below within a period of six weeks from today in connection with Complaint Case No. 419 of 2014

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.9084 of 2016 (2) dt.14-09-2016 3/3 pending in the court of learned Chief Judicial Magistrate, Nawada.

Accordingly, this application is disposed of. (Dinesh Kumar Singh, J) DKS/- U T
